FOAM COMPOSITIONS
A foaming antiperspirant or deodorant composition comprising: a. an oil and water emulsion; b. a first blowing agent with at least 0.1% water solubility at 20° C.; and c. a second blowing agent with a water solubility of at most 0.01% at 20° C.

COMPOSITIONS IN THE FORM OF DISSOLVABLE SOLID STRUCTURES
Described are effervescent dissolvable solid structures having fibers formed from a composition comprising surfactant and water soluble polymeric structurant, having a total dissolvable solid structure density of from about 0.100 g/cm.sup.3 to about 0.380 g/cm.sup.3, having a surfactant dose of from about 0.5 to about 2.0 g, and a surfactant density of from about 0.1 g/cm.sup.3 to about 0.3 g/cm.sup.3. Also described are processes for manufacturing the Dissolvable Solid Structure.

SOLID CLEANSING COMPOSITION COMPRISING AN ACYL ALKYL ISETHIONATE
A solid cleansing composition comprising: (i) at least one acyl alkyl isethionate surfactant of the formula (I): wherein R1 represents an optionally substituted C4-C36 hydrocarbyl group; each of R2, R3, R4 and R5 independently represents hydrogen or a C1-C4 alkyl group and wherein at least one of R2, R3, R4 and R5 is not hydrogen; and M+ represents a cation; (ii) a salt of carbonic acid; and (iii) an organic acid.
AEROSOL COMPOSITION
An aerosol composition including an aerosol stock solution containing a cationic surfactant (A) and a linear saturated higher alcohol (B), and a propellant (C) containing carbon dioxide. The component (A) containing a mono-long-chain-alkyl cationic surfactant (A1). A content of the component (A) being 0.9% by mass or more and less than 6.0% by mass in the aerosol stock solution. A molar ratio [(B)/(A1)] of the component (B) with respect to the component (A1) being 3.0 or more and 7.0 or less in the aerosol stock solution. A content of the component (A1) in the component (A) being 90% by mass or more and 100% by mass or less, and a difference between a number of carbon atoms of the long-chain alkyl in the component (A1) and the number of carbon atoms of the component (B) being 0.

CRACKLING HAND SANITIZER FORMULATIONS AND ASSOCIATED METHODS
A composition and associated methods of manufacture for a new type of hand sanitizer that has a “crackling” effect when the user rubs it between their hands. Crackling hand sanitizer formulations promote hand sanitizing because of the interactive user experience provided during application and use of the formulations. A hand sanitizer concentrate solution mixed with a propellant and thickening agent results in a formulation that provides a crackling effect when applied to the hands by a user. The “crackling effect” is a physical reaction when the formulation is in contact with the user's skin, in which the propellant evaporates, causing a crackling sound while also providing a tingling or effervescent feeling on the skin.
Effervescent foot bath and method
An effervescent foot bath which employs an acid in combination with a carbonated base to produces a effervescing effect in a closed foot tub. The reaction has been designed to function externally to soften and begin the process of removing dry, rough peeling skin from the feet.
